Royal Starr Film Festival

200 N Main St, Royal Oak, MI 48067
Royal Starr Film Festival Royal Starr Film Festival is one of the popular Arts & Entertainment located in 200 N Main St ,Royal Oak listed under Non-profit organization in Royal Oak , Arts & Entertainment in Royal Oak ,

Contact Details & Working Hours

Map of Royal Starr Film Festival